Runcorn, Warrington, United Kingdom

Overview

Runcorn is a riverside town in the North West of England, blending historic charm and modern convenience. Its industrial heritage, scenic waterfront, and proximity to Liverpool make it a practical base for exploring the region.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for mild weather and outdoor activities.

Local Tips

Consider day trips to Liverpool or Chester via train. Local buses are efficient for exploring neighborhoods, but taxis can be limited at night.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ping in restaurants is appreciated (around 10%). Dress is generally casual. Greet shop staff and respect queues.

Safety Warnings

Central areas are generally safe, but stay aware around the transport interchange at night. Avoid isolated canal paths after dark. Petty theft is uncommon, but keep valuables secure.

Hidden Gems

Runcorn Hill Park offers panoramic views and peaceful walks; explore the atmospheric Norton Priory Museum and Gardens for local history away from the crowds.
